Weyburn lifters to compete at World Sub-Junior/Junior Powerlifting Championships

Weyburn lifters to compete at World Sub-Junior/Junior Powerlifting Championships

The World Sub-Junior/Junior Powerlifting Championships will be held in Regina from August 26-31.Saskatchewan will have six athletes participating in the event with three hailing from Weyburn.

Weyburn waterpolo goalie helps Team Canada earn silver medal

Weyburn waterpolo goalie helps Team Canada earn silver medal

Rumina Edgerton of Weyburn, a goalie for Team Canada’s U17 women’s waterpolo team, returned home with a silver medal along with her team after competing at the Pan American Youth Waterpolo Championships in Trinidad.

Young Fellows give last instalment for Weyburn paddling pool

Young Fellows give last instalment for Weyburn paddling pool

Members of the Young Fellows Club of Weyburn gathered to present their final instalment of $25,000, as part of a five-year commitment to donate $125,000 in funds towards the paddling pool at the Don Mitchell Tot Lot on Monday.
